Airbrush Makeup For Women of Color

For anyone who has had this on their wedding day or doing their trial:
Was the makeup artist able to match your skin tone? I am scared that it will be too dark or look "ashy". I will go for a trial probably next month but I am curious.

    I had it done for our engagement pictures and for the bridals last week.  Pics are in my bio.  Personally, I love it.  I have a lot of blotches on my face, so the coverage of that was awesome.  I think the skill of the MUA determines how well you will actually look.  Go for the trial and see how you like it.

    My make-up artist did a perfect job matching my skin tone. It looked so natural. She actually mixes the color for each client so it's perfect.

    I too did them for my engagement pictures and she was able to match my skin tone. It took a lot of work because of the lighting in the room, but she ultimately got it.
    I thought the make up was too much but the photographer and my fi really like it and it came out great ont he pictures.

    It lasted ALL day. I had to scrub my face at 2 AM to take it all off. lol!
